Pros & cons
Happy Scribe
+ Strong language and subtitle support
+ Choice of automatic or human accuracy
- Not a live meeting bot
Kixie
+ Combines high-volume parallel dialing with AI conversation intelligence in one platform
+ Real-time coaching with whisper/barge plus a Call Strength Score reduces manual call review
- Centered on its own dialer, so it is less suited to teams that only need post-meeting analysis of video calls
